Gary Gottlieb, "How Does It Sound Now?: Legendary Engineers and Vintage Gear (Artistpro)"

Chet Atkins was playing his guitar when a woman approached him. She said, “That guitar sounds beautiful.” Chet immediately quit playing. Staring her in the eyes, he asked, “How does it sound now?” The quality of the sound in Chet’s case clearly rested with the player, not the instrument, and the quality of our product ultimately lies with us as engineers and producers, not with the gear we use. How Does It Sound Now? Legendary Engineers and Vintage Gear contains insightful interviews with 31 of the most famous audio engineers of all time on how they utilized (and in some cases invented) classic analog recording hardware to make some of the highest quality recordings of all time. Each interview provides a walkthrough of audio and music history as you learn how some of your favorite recordings came to be made. But the interviews don’t only reveal what gear was used and why. Throughout the discussions, each interviewee brings up how creating quality recordings was and always will be the ultimate goal of the engineer. And of course, a big reason why each of these legendary engineers was so successful was that their standards for quality were so high. The interviews are loaded with advice and insight on how recording is an art form and how one might go about becoming a master.
